Address

MREZaMb4e7i1hksgHXa5PtK2pXuFPi629n

0 MONA

Confirmed
Total Received3.45118609 MONA
Total Sent3.45118609 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MREZaMb4e7i1hksgHXa5PtK2pXuFPi629n3.45118609 MONA
 
 
MREZaMb4e7i1hksgHXa5PtK2pXuFPi629n3.45118609 MONA